This robot came as a kit that needed to be assembled. It utilized an Arduino Uno, an ESP32 camera, ultrasonic sensor for obstacle avoidance, infrared sensor for remote control, and many other capabilities. I bought this car the first semester I attended UAT. The reason I purchased it was because it was made out of open-source components including the source code. This allowed me to build, tweak, and expand this robot as I learned more about the hardware and software. I used this robot as my at-home robot to practice programming. I have since added a few extra features such as a control for the speed in which the robot turns, remote control via Wi-Fi, and am working on using the camera and ultrasonic sensor together for better obstacle avoidance.
